Training needs assessment in occupational risk prevention into schools
2011
The assessment of needs plays a relevant role in the training for preventing of risks at work into school, as it is a scientific procedure to identify and prioritise problems existing within an educative context. This type of assessment is the starting point for a subsequent planning of the educative interventions that will enable pupils and teachers to act on potential deficiencies detected into risks of school. The present study proposes a model with practical guidelines to develop this type of educative interventions within the risk prevention area, as it will allow us to: (a) Gather reliable information about existing problems; (b) Take action to fulfil the needs of the pupils and teachers; (c) Carry out assessments, and (d) Make decisions with regard to the distribution of resources and planning of educative intervention programmes.
